Output 51e46e720cf6d03b74e83be8e64ef90f5bd7011fbb65ceaafca71f4ffde14f8f:0

value
723339
script pubkey
OP_0 OP_PUSHBYTES_20 ce399421d78832c5f5d7b394793340727301fdc6
address
bc1qecueggwh3qevtawhkw28jv6qwfesrlwxmmfdu4
transaction
51e46e720cf6d03b74e83be8e64ef90f5bd7011fbb65ceaafca71f4ffde14f8f
confirmations
13635
spent
true